Background
Langford, J. Jerry was born on May 19, 1933 in Birmingham, Alabama, United States.

University of Southern Mississippi (Bachelor of Science, 1955). University of Mississippi (Juris Doctor, 1970).
Worked at Wells Marble & Hurst, Professional Limited Liability Company (Jackson, Mississippi) specializing in General Civil Practice in all State and Federal Courts. Business, Corporation, Banking, Finance and Securities. Creditors" Rights and Bankruptcy.
Dispute Resolution Services.
Employee Benefit Law (including Employee Retirement Income Security Act). Insurance Regulatory Proceedings.
Labor and Employment. Life, Health, Property, Casualty and other Insurance.
Product Liability; Real Estate.
Taxation, Estate Planning, Wills, Trusts and Estates. Toxic Substances, Environmental and Natural Resources. Admitted to the bar, 1970, Mississippi.
Omicron Delta Kappa.
Phi Delta Phi. Editor-in-Chief, Mississippi Law Journal, 1969-1970. Member: Hinds County, Federal (President, Mississippi Chapter, 1981-1982) and American (Member, Section of Tort and Insurance Practice Law) Bar Associations.
The Mississippi Bar (Chairman, Group Insurance Committee, 1987-1989, 1992-1993. Chairman, Client Security Fund Committee, 1996).
Bar Association of the Fifth Federal Circuit.
Lamar Society of International Law (President, 1969). Mississippi Oil and Gas Lawyers Association (Vice-President, 1974-1975). Mississippi Bar Foundation.
Defense Research Institute, Incorporated.
Mississippi Defense Lawyers Association (Vice President, 1988-1990. Secretary-Treasurer, 1990.
President-Elect, 1991. President, 1992); National Association of Railroad Trial Counsel.
Federation of Insurance and Corporate Counsel (Chairman, Railroad Law Committee, 1983-1984).
Wells Marble & Hurst, Professional Limited Liability Company, traces its origin to 1871, when William Calvin Wells began practicing law. With a broad base of local and national clients, the firm is committed to providing a full range of quality legal services. The firm is active in both civic and bar-related activities, and has provided Presidents of the Mississippi Bar, the Mississippi Defense Lawyers Association, and numerous other organizations.
The firm"s members and associates continue a long tradition of personal attention to the legal needs of its diverse clientele.
The firm is engaged in a diversified general civil practice in all State and Federal courts in Mississippi.
